It is a dam that curves upstream in a narrowing curve that directs most of the force from the water against the rock walls, which provide the force to compress the dam. It combines the strengths of two common dam forms and is a compromise between the two. They are made of conventional , roller-compacted concrete (RCC), or . An arch–gravity dam can be thinner than a pure and requires less internal fill.


Overview
Arch–gravity dams are dams that resist the thrust of water by their weight using the force of and the .

An arch–gravity dam incorporates the 's curved design which is effective in supporting the water in narrow, rocky locations where the 's sides are of hard rock and the water is forced into a narrow channel. Therefore, the span needed for the dam is also relatively narrow, and the dam's curved design effectively holds the water back while using less construction material than a pure arch dam or pure gravity dam. These dams are more reliable than arch dams. Typically, arch–gravity dams are built in canyon-like terrain, with the surrounding cliffs serving as supporting walls. An arch-shaped bank-fill design reduces the overall mass of the structure and the cost of construction compared to pure gravity dams. Arch dams and arch–gravity dams are most commonly used in hydraulic structures of more than 100m in height.
